July - Crab

Crab is low in calories - a four ounce serving of crab meat has only 98 calories, full of flavour and with under two grams of fat per serving, it's heart healthy too. Despite its low calories, it's high protein content (crab has almost half the protein an average woman needs in a day) makes it a really filling and satisfying food.
Crab is also great for kids as it's also a good source of brain enhancing, immune boosting omega three fatty acids. Omega 3's also help to lower triglycerides and blood pressure, reduce the risk of heart disease and even lower the risk of certain types of cancer. Try topping a salad with flakes of fresh crab meat, stir into pasta dishes or add tinned crab meat to fish cakes or fish pies.
